Buffanblu pull away from Na Menehune, 66-51


  

Thu, Dec 3, 2015 @ Radford

Chris Kobayashi scored 15 points and Jared Lum and Kaulana Makaula added 10 apiece to help Punahou to a 66-51 win over Moanalua in the nightcap of Thursday's second day of the 17th Annual James Alegre Invitational at Radford High School.

The Buffanblu (3-0) rallied from a 29-25 deficit at halftime. They outscored Na Menehune (1-1) in the third quarter, 22 to 7.

James Wilkins had 16 points and Caleb Casinas added 13 for Moanalua.

Both teams wil be back on the court Friday. Punahou takes on Mililani at 4:30 p.m. and Moanalua faces Honokaa at 6 p.m.
